      ....The Israelites set out on foot from RAMSES for SUKKOTH. They were about six hundred thousands of Man, not counting the women and children. The Israelites had lived in Egypt for 430 years.

      When Pharaoh, the king of Egypt was told that the Israelites had all gone and we have lost them as our slaves, he and his officials changed their minds, and then the king got his war chariots and armed forces to pursue and arrest the Israelites who were now leaving truimphantly, and under the protection of their Lord. When the Israelites saw the king and his forces in pursuit, they were terrified and cried out to God for help. Moses said to them:ِ

      ``Don't be afraid! The Lord is with us, stand your ground and you will see what our Lord will do to save you to-day.'' Then Moses held out his hand over the sea, and the Lord drove the sea back with a strong east wind. The sea path was turned to a dry land and the water was divided in two parts. The Israelites passed the sea with walls of water on both sides.

      When the king and his army pursued them, the Lord said to Moses hold out your hand over the sea. Moses did so and the water returned to its normal levels. All the Egyptions in pursuit were drowned, not one of them left alive!
